Tom Lane 3c2313f481 Change the pgstat logic so that the stats collector writes the stats file only
upon requests from backends, rather than on a fixed 500msec cycle.  (There's
still throttling logic to ensure it writes no more often than once per
500msec, though.)  This should result in a significant reduction in stats file
write traffic in typical scenarios where the stats are demanded only
infrequently.

This approach also means that the former difficulty with changing
stats_temp_directory on-the-fly has gone away, so remove the caution about
that as well as the thrashing we did to minimize the trouble window.

In passing, also fix pgstat_report_stat() so that we will send a stats
message if we have function call stats but not table stats to report;
this fixes a bug in the recent patch to support function-call stats.

Heikki Linnakangas e9816533e3 Update FSM on WAL replay. This is a bit limited; the FSM is only updated
on non-full-page-image WAL records, and quite arbitrarily, only if there's
less than 20% free space on the page after the insert/update (not on HOT
updates, though). The 20% cutoff should avoid most of the overhead, when
replaying a bulk insertion, for example, while ensuring that pages that
are full are marked as full in the FSM.

This is mostly to avoid the nasty worst case scenario, where you replay
from a PITR archive, and the FSM information in the base backup is really
out of date. If there was a lot of pages that the outdated FSM claims to
have free space, but don't actually have any, the first unlucky inserter
after the recovery would traverse through all those pages, just to find
out that they're full. We didn't have this problem with the old FSM
implementation, because we simply threw the FSM information away on a
non-clean shutdown.

Tom Lane 312b1a983f Reduce the memory footprint of large pending-trigger-event lists, as per my
recent proposal.  In typical cases, we now need 12 bytes per insert or delete
event and 16 bytes per update event; previously we needed 40 bytes per
event on 32-bit hardware and 80 bytes per event on 64-bit hardware.  Even
in the worst case usage pattern with a large number of distinct triggers being
fired in one query, usage is at most 32 bytes per event.  It seems to be a
bit faster than the old code as well, due to reduction of palloc overhead.

This commit doesn't address the TODO item of allowing the event list to spill
to disk; rather it's trying to stave off the need for that.  However, it
probably makes that task a bit easier by reducing the data structure's
dependency on pointers.  It would now be practical to dump an event list to
disk by "chunks" instead of individual events.

Tom Lane e6ae3b5dbf Add a concept of "placeholder" variables to the planner. These are variables
that represent some expression that we desire to compute below the top level
of the plan, and then let that value "bubble up" as though it were a plain
Var (ie, a column value).

The immediate application is to allow sub-selects to be flattened even when
they are below an outer join and have non-nullable output expressions.
Formerly we couldn't flatten because such an expression wouldn't properly
go to NULL when evaluated above the outer join.  Now, we wrap it in a
PlaceHolderVar and arrange for the actual evaluation to occur below the outer
join.  When the resulting Var bubbles up through the join, it will be set to
NULL if necessary, yielding the correct results.  This fixes a planner
limitation that's existed since 7.1.

In future we might want to use this mechanism to re-introduce some form of
Hellerstein's "expensive functions" optimization, ie place the evaluation of
an expensive function at the most suitable point in the plan tree.

Tom Lane 4adc2f72a4 Change hash indexes to store only the hash code rather than the whole indexed
value.  This means that hash index lookups are always lossy and have to be
rechecked when the heap is visited; however, the gain in index compactness
outweighs this when the indexed values are wide.  Also, we only need to
perform datatype comparisons when the hash codes match exactly, rather than
for every entry in the hash bucket; so it could also win for datatypes that
have expensive comparison functions.  A small additional win is gained by
keeping hash index pages sorted by hash code and using binary search to reduce
the number of index tuples we have to look at.

Xiao Meng

This commit also incorporates Zdenek Kotala's patch to isolate hash metapages
and hash bitmaps a bit better from the page header datastructures.

Tom Lane bd3daddaf2 Arrange to convert EXISTS subqueries that are equivalent to hashable IN
subqueries into the same thing you'd have gotten from IN (except always with
unknownEqFalse = true, so as to get the proper semantics for an EXISTS).
I believe this fixes the last case within CVS HEAD in which an EXISTS could
give worse performance than an equivalent IN subquery.

The tricky part of this is that if the upper query probes the EXISTS for only
a few rows, the hashing implementation can actually be worse than the default,
and therefore we need to make a cost-based decision about which way to use.
But at the time when the planner generates plans for subqueries, it doesn't
really know how many times the subquery will be executed.  The least invasive
solution seems to be to generate both plans and postpone the choice until
execution.  Therefore, in a query that has been optimized this way, EXPLAIN
will show two subplans for the EXISTS, of which only one will actually get
executed.

There is a lot more that could be done based on this infrastructure: in
particular it's interesting to consider switching to the hash plan if we start
out using the non-hashed plan but find a lot more upper rows going by than we
expected.  I have therefore left some minor inefficiencies in place, such as
initializing both subplans even though we will currently only use one.

Tom Lane e006a24ad1 Implement SEMI and ANTI joins in the planner and executor. (Semijoins replace
the old JOIN_IN code, but antijoins are new functionality.)  Teach the planner
to convert appropriate EXISTS and NOT EXISTS subqueries into semi and anti
joins respectively.  Also, LEFT JOINs with suitable upper-level IS NULL
filters are recognized as being anti joins.  Unify the InClauseInfo and
OuterJoinInfo infrastructure into "SpecialJoinInfo".  With that change,
it becomes possible to associate a SpecialJoinInfo with every join attempt,
which permits some cleanup of join selectivity estimation.  That needs to be
taken much further than this patch does, but the next step is to change the
API for oprjoin selectivity functions, which seems like material for a
separate patch.  So for the moment the output size estimates for semi and
especially anti joins are quite bogus.

Heikki Linnakangas 3f0e808c4a Introduce the concept of relation forks. An smgr relation can now consist
of multiple forks, and each fork can be created and grown separately.

The bulk of this patch is about changing the smgr API to include an extra
ForkNumber argument in every smgr function. Also, smgrscheduleunlink and
smgrdounlink no longer implicitly call smgrclose, because other forks might
still exist after unlinking one. The callers of those functions have been
modified to call smgrclose instead.

This patch in itself doesn't have any user-visible effect, but provides the
infrastructure needed for upcoming patches. The additional forks envisioned
are a rewritten FSM implementation that doesn't rely on a fixed-size shared
memory block, and a visibility map to allow skipping portions of a table in
VACUUM that have no dead tuples.
